Understanding and Targeting the Endocannabinoid System with Activity‐Based Protein Profiling

Na Zhu, Antonius P. A. Janssen, Mario van der Stelt

Abstract The endocannabinoid system (ECS) is a widespread modulatory system composed of cannabinoid receptors, endogenous signaling lipids termed endocannabinoids and the enzymes for the biosynthesis and degradation of these endocannabinoids. It plays a crucial role in diverse (patho)physiological functions, such as neurotransmission, …
